Real Property Conveyances and Registration – consist of the services necessary for the legal transfer of ownership or rights in a land or building. This service may include drafting of necessary deeds or in some instances, settlement of estates. Registration on the other hand, is the official and public recording of a land transfer with the Land Registration Authority (LRA), through the Registry of Deeds. The registration of a property declares the title of the registered owner and protects the owner from certain adverse claims.

Estate Settlements – consist of services necessary in identifying the properties of the deceased, identifying legal heirs, paying of estate taxes and other local taxes owing to any property left by the deceased, as well as distributing properties among the legal heirs of the deceased, and other services required to obtain the objectives of settling estates. This service is teamed with the transfer and registration of properties to the heirs as new owners thereof through succession. This service may be done without court intervention through a Deed/Affidavit, if certain requisites are complied with or through probate proceedings in court, if there is a valid Will and Testament.

Notarial Services – consists of witnessing the execution of a document, instrument, or deed by our in-house notary public which transforms a private document into a public document thereby verifying the identity of the parties executing the document as well as their voluntariness to enter into the transaction or execute the document. Notarizing documents prevents any questions on the documents authenticity, which makes the same conclusive even before the courts.
